Understanding Lawful Costs
When you're dealing with criminal charges, understanding legal charges is important. You require to know what costs to expect and how they might affect your funds. The majority of criminal defense attorneys bill either a level cost or a per hour price. A flat charge can offer you a clear image of your complete prices ahead of time, while hourly rates can vary based on the complexity of your instance.
It's also essential to consider retainer costs, which are upfront repayments to safeguard your attorney's solutions. This charge frequently covers initial job, however you'll need to keep an eye on just how swiftly those funds are used up.
Ensure you ask about additional costs that could emerge, like court costs or professional witness costs.
Don't think twice to go over payment plans with your lawyer if the costs appear overwhelming. Many lawyers agree to deal with you to make payments much more workable.
Transparency is crucial, so ensure you obtain whatever in writing to prevent surprises later on. Recognizing these aspects of lawful costs can aid you make informed decisions and reduce stress and anxiety during a difficult time.

Structure a Strong Defense
From the minute you hire a criminal defense lawyer, constructing a strong defense becomes your leading priority. Your lawyer will begin collecting evidence and assessing all facets of your case, so it's vital to give them with accurate and complete information. Be open and straightforward concerning the details surrounding your circumstance, regardless of exactly how tiny they may seem.
Next off, your attorney will certainly assess the evidence versus you and recognize any weaknesses in the prosecution's instance. This could include questioning the legitimacy of proof or the trustworthiness of witnesses. It's necessary to remain involved throughout this procedure; ask concerns and voice any kind of problems you have.
Additionally, work with your attorney to develop an approach customized to your particular circumstances. This could consist of bargaining plea offers or preparing for trial. Bear in mind, your cooperation is vital.
Ultimately, stay notified concerning your legal rights and the legal process. Recognizing what's at stake will equip you to make enlightened choices.
Developing a strong defense isn't simply your lawyer's work-- it's a collaboration that requires your active engagement. Together, you can produce the best feasible end result for your case.
